Tesla Autopilot Safety Defeat Device Gets a Cease-and-Desist From NHTSA
schwit1 writes: The National Highway Traffic Safety Association (NHTSA) is cracking down on a device that was designed to trick Tesla's semi-autonomous Autopilot feature into thinking a driver is paying attention, in order to extend the amount of time that it will operate without anyone touching the steering wheel. NHTSA announced on Tuesday that it has sent a cease and desist letter to the makers of Autopilot Buddy, and has given the company until June 29 to end sales and distribution of the $199 product. The device is a two-piece weighted hoop with magnets that wraps around a steering wheel spoke and registers with the car's sensors as a hand on the wheel. Autopilot is programmed to disengage after a short period of time if the driver is not touching the wheel and ignores a series of alerts to take control.unity.Read more of this story at Slashdot.
